Edam Cheese Biscuits Recipe

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
2 cups flour
1/2 tsp. salt
4 tsp. baking powder
4 tsp. sugar
1/4 tsp. coarsely ground pepper
1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
3/4 cup shredded Edam cheese (3 oz)
1 cup milk

Directions:
Directions:
Preheat oven to 400º F. Combine flour, salt, baking powder, sugar and pepper in large mixing bowl. Cut in butter until mixture is crumbly. Stir in cheese. Add milk. Stir to make a sticky dough. Drop batter by 1/4 measuring cupfuls onto greased baking sheet. Bake for 20 minutes or until golden brown.
